More on the Health glitch
So it turns out that the health glitch discovered by Nak3d Eli isn’t new to the Title Update of Reach – Chris101b did some experimenting with an non-updated Xbox, and found that the non-regenerating health has ALWAYS been present in Reach. It’s just that before bleedthrough was implemented (in the TU), it was unnoticeable. (If you had shields, they absorbed the melee. If you didn’t, you died. It was that simple.) He tweaked the initial conditions (increased health/damage resistance) in order to allow a player to survive that first melee hit – and then showed that a SECOND melee, even after picking up a health pack, would kill. So: old bug, but new circumstances make it relevant now.(Louis Wu 10:26:06 UTC)

TU Health Glitch Analysis – More Data
Nak3d Eli continues his investigation into the odd health behavior manifesting itself in the post-Title Update Reach. Check out his latest video, which narrows down some of the causes. (The biggest surprise for me was the fact that after at least 5 melees, one shot and a melee will always kill you.) (Louis Wu 16:03:53 UTC)

Passing the Halo Baton
ElzarTheBam noticed a short bit on Xbox360Achievements – Frank O’Connor talks about the passing of the Halo baton. He remembers the transition in August as being ‘pretty seamless’ (I’d say ‘relatively smooth’, myself; I remember some glitches), and he points out that the Halo engine is owned by Microsoft (not really a newsflash, but nice to have something to point at if people ask). Now they just have to bring it home!(Louis Wu 16:00:41 UTC)
